Nintendo Wii Game News: Black Ops 2 Locations Revealed: The Secret Numbers Uncover Eight Maps

Posted by on May 01, 2012 | Leave a Comment

Could it be that the Black Ops 2 locations have been revealed? We’ve uncovered eight locations that you may play in the single player story of Call of Duty: Black Ops 2. If you look closely at the Call of Duty: Black Ops 2 trailer, you will see a set of numbers during the Treyarch logo scene that reveal dates and coordinates. Nintendo Facing Limits As Wii U Launch Approaches

Posted by on May 01, 2012 | Leave a Comment

Nintendo can’t do everything. While the company has pledged time and again that it will be ready for the launch of Wii U in a way that it was not for the 3DS in 2011, global president Satoru Iwata admits his teams can only do so much. “There is always a limit to our internal resources,” Iwata told a group of investors last week in Japan. “The company now has to develop software for the Nintendo 3DS, has to prepare for the Wii U launch and has to finalize the hardware functionalities....
